Bummskopf Posted September 2, 2009 Share Posted September 2, 2009 i think i can help you, i have a gigabyte ga-p35-ds3r (rev 2.0, bios f13) too and got snow leopard working on it. I created a DSDT.aml with sound (ALC889a) , cmos fix, network realtek 8168 (AppleRTL8169 says IORegistryExplorer) based on the bios file f13 from the gigabyte website. I have a GA-P35-DS3R, not sure which revision, but bios f13. tried installing snow leopard. had some issues b/c AHCI has to be enabled in my already installed VISTA HDD that was installed with BIOS defaults (AHCI NOT ENABLED!) needless to say this causes a BSOD when vista tries to load. Registry fixes can be applied to fix this. So i can get into OSX installation. but i have a Raid 0 Array for my D:\ drive that i can't get to show up. Is RAID not AHCI? does this mean there is no way to get the drives to appear in OSX?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
